To Manufacture products / components by supervising staff, reporting on performance, organizing, and monitoring workflow.
To ensure that products / components are produced according to specification (Quality) within the planned time (Efficiency) at the correct cost (Reduced waste / Productivity improvements).
To uphold company policies and procedures and lead improvement projects within the relevant work areas.
PROCESS BASIC EDUCATIONAL
REQUIREMENTS: Formal schooling/degree
NSC Matric certificate.
Trade: Fitter & Turner (essential) Experience:
Minimum 5 years of related experience, preferably in the Mechanical Industry. Languages:
English and Afrikaans.
MAIN D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
Achieving production performance through: o Ensure that all operations are performed in line with the correct planning (Production Method, Time, and Quality). o Recording and reporting of daily production - provides manufacturing information by compiling, initiating, sorting, and analyzing production records and data. o Maintaining workflow by identifying and understanding bottleneck operations / processes and implementing sustainability corrective actions to remedy the situation. o Achieving the Production Plan, introducing initiatives to make up for any lost time or scrap components. o Ensuring the correct staffing and shift coverage. o Highlighting any adverse trends in terms of production and / or equipment to relevant department for remedial action. o Ensuring that all processes and operations performed in the relevant work area are understood in terms of Quality, Capability, Capacity and Legal compliance. Ensuring that the Quality is in accordance with the requirements: o Comply with all requirements as per the Quality Manual. o
Ensuring that all relevant quality action (in accordance with the IMDS)
are adhered to. o Ensuring that all the components, assemblies and materials are identified and labelled accordingly. o Ensuring that all Quality related issues are dealt with timeously and rectified.
Ensure that all machines and equipment is suitably maintained: o Ensure that the basic operator maintenance is performed. o Ensuring that the Maintenance system are adhered to i.e., Breakdown and TPM forms completely timeously.
Staff discipline: o Managing staff through training, coaching, counselling, and discipline employees where necessary. o Recording and controlling absenteeism. o Enforcing organization standards with regards to Policies and Procedures, Legal and Quality compliance. o Ensuring staff training is performed and recorded.
Stock control: o Ensuring that all system processes are adhered to (ERP system and fundamental processes). o Controlling works Orders. o Ensuring scrap and rejects are dealt with to ensure that the system requirements are met.
Roll out of Lean Manufacturing Principles: o Ensuring housekeeping. o 5 S. o Visual management.
Day-to-Day Responsibilities:
Organize and oversee daily operations across the Autos, Press, and Plating sections. o Ensure swift setup, calibration, and operational readiness of Tornos Cam Auto machines. o Monitor tool, cam, and machine consumables levels to ensure availability and minimize production delays. o Conduct tooling inspections, ensure correct setups, and troubleshoot issues related to press tooling. o Conduct routine checks on machines, dies, and plating equipment, ensuring proper function. o Track production output, report key metrics, and suggest process improvements. o Provide hands-on technical support to resolve production-related issues. Ensuring a safe working environment: o Ensuring the full compliance regarding Safe works procedures, PPE, etc. o Accept responsibility in accordance with the relevant safety appointment. o Fostering open working relations with all supporting departments. o Control of costs associated within your department i.e., production costs, scrap, consumables, etc. o Contributes to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ed. K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S: o On Time Delivery. o Producing components to the correct quality standards. o Percentage of Units Reworked. o Labour cost. o Production Target. INTERPERSONAL SKILLS/VALUES: o Good communications skills (verbal/non-verbal). o Effective decision maker and results oriented. o Critical Thinking and Problem-solving ability. o Conflict handling and resolution skills. o Ability to work in a high-pressure environment.
COMPETENCIES, KNOWLEDGE, AND SKILLS: o Production and Processing - Knowledge of raw materials, producing processes, quality control, cost, and other techniques for maximizing the effective manufacture and distribution of component. o Personnel and HR - Knowledge of principles and procedures for personnel recruitment, training, and Labour relations. o Mechanical - Knowledge of machine and told, including their designs, uses, repair and maintenance. o Knowledge and understanding of product manufactured and technologies employees. o Knowledge of company systems and procedures. o Sound knowledge of safety regulations. o Inventory management practices. o Managing and Process improvement. o Supply management. o Production control. o Supervision. o Production Planning.
